Sand x Black Habotai Silk Scarf | Large Fine-Weave | Itajime Hand Dyed | By Khatri Brothers Bhuj, India scarf VARSHA means Rain in SanskritUltra lightweight and lustrous Habotai silk scarf, large; in sand, black and white using (Itajime) clamp dye technique, low impact Azo free dyes by Abdullah and Abduljabar, India. A contemporary, oversized style, it's an ideal travel companion or trans seasonal accessory. 100% Habotai Fine weave Silk Approximately 100x200cm ~ WHO MADE MY CLOTHES?
